correctly means sitting there for 5 minutes doing nothing resting before the blood pressure is checked it also means having a cuff that fits correctly having the arm at the level of the right atrium so about mid chest here uh not having your legs crossed when it's checked and I always like to check it in duplicate or triplicate and uh if a person can do that twice a day for a couple of weeks once a year again not a huge inconvenience in my view then they can have a real assessment of their blood pressure
